Ethiopia Opens Honorary Consulate in Hong Kong
The Ethiopian Foreign Ministry confirmed Wednesday that Ethiopia has opened an honorary consulate in the Hong Kong Special Administrative Region (HKSAR) of China.

The ministry noted that the consulate was officially opened in Hong Kong on March 27 in the presence of HKSAR Secretary for Justice Elsie Leung Oi-sie, Ji Peiding, commissioner of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of China in the HKSAR, and representatives of the business community in Hong Kong.
The Ethiopian ministry believed that the opening of the consulate has a significant importance in further enhancing the growing Ethio-Hong Kong economic and tourism ties.
